Unlocking the Power of OpenClaw Skills A Comprehensive Guide for Modern AI Automation

Introduction to OpenClaw Skills and Their Significance in AI Automation

In the rapidly evolving landscape of artificial intelligence, the ability to customize and extend AI capabilities has become paramount for developers and businesses alike. openclaw skills OpenClaw, a locally-running AI assistant, offers a unique approach to this through its innovative use of skills. These OpenClaw skills serve as modular building blocks that empower AI agents to perform specific tasks with precision and efficiency. As organizations seek more tailored automation solutions, understanding how to leverage and develop OpenClaw skills can be a game-changer in optimizing workflows and enhancing productivity.

Understanding OpenClaw Skills: The Foundation of Custom AI Capabilities

What Are OpenClaw Skills?

OpenClaw skills are essentially markdown files containing instructional code designed to teach AI agents how to execute particular tasks. These skills are compatible with AgentSkills, a framework that facilitates the integration of various functionalities into the AI assistant. By utilizing skills, developers can extend the AI’s capabilities, making it more versatile and aligned with specific operational requirements. This modular approach allows for rapid customization without altering the core AI system.

The Structure and Components of Skills

Each OpenClaw skill typically includes detailed instructions, trigger conditions, and action sequences. The structure is straightforward, making it accessible for developers to create or modify skills according to their needs. Skills can range from simple automation commands to complex workflows involving multiple steps and tools. This flexibility ensures that OpenClaw can adapt to diverse use cases across industries such as finance, healthcare, and software development.

Developing Effective OpenClaw Skills: Best Practices and Strategies

Designing Skills for Reusability and Scalability

Creating effective OpenClaw skills requires a focus on reusability. Developers should design skills that can be easily adapted or extended for different scenarios. Modular design principles, such as building small, single-purpose skills that can be combined, help in scaling automation efforts efficiently. Additionally, maintaining clear documentation within each skill ensures ease of updates and troubleshooting.

Incorporating Automation and Trigger Mechanisms

One of the strengths of OpenClaw skills is their ability to set up automation workflows. By identifying repetitive tasks and configuring triggers and actions, developers can significantly reduce manual intervention. For instance, skills can be programmed to activate upon specific events, such as receiving an email or reaching a particular data threshold, thereby enabling real-time responsiveness and continuous operation.

Testing and Refinement of Skills

To ensure the effectiveness of OpenClaw skills, rigorous testing is essential. Developers should simulate various scenarios to verify that skills perform as intended. Feedback loops and iterative refinement help in optimizing performance, reducing errors, and enhancing reliability. This process is critical for deploying skills in production environments where stability is paramount.

Practical Applications and Use Cases of OpenClaw Skills

Automation in Business Processes

OpenClaw skills are extensively used to automate complex business workflows. Tasks such as data entry, report generation, customer support, and email management can be streamlined by developing tailored skills. This not only boosts efficiency but also minimizes human error, leading to more accurate and timely outputs.

Enhancing AI Personal Assistants

For personal AI assistants, skills expand their utility beyond basic commands. Users can customize skills to manage schedules, fetch information, control smart devices, or perform internet searches. These personalized skills create a more intuitive and productive user experience, making AI assistants more valuable in daily life and work.

Supporting Developer and Data Science Tasks

Data scientists and developers benefit from OpenClaw skills by automating data preprocessing, model training, and deployment tasks. Custom skills can facilitate seamless integration with data tools, enabling more efficient experimentation and iteration. This accelerates project timelines and fosters innovation in AI development.

Future Perspectives: The Evolving Role of OpenClaw Skills in AI Ecosystems

As AI technology advances, the role of skills in platforms like OpenClaw is expected to expand further. The increasing demand for personalized automation solutions will drive the development of more sophisticated, easy-to-create skills. Integration with other AI frameworks and tools will enhance interoperability, making OpenClaw a central component in comprehensive AI ecosystems. Developers and organizations should stay abreast of emerging trends to harness the full potential of OpenClaw skills, ensuring their AI systems remain flexible, scalable, and highly functional.

Conclusion

OpenClaw skills represent a pivotal innovation in the realm of AI automation, enabling users to tailor their AI assistants to specific tasks and workflows. By understanding the structure, development practices, and application scenarios of these skills, organizations can unlock new levels of efficiency and productivity. As the AI landscape continues to evolve, mastering OpenClaw skills will be essential for those looking to stay ahead in automation and intelligent system design. Whether for business automation, personal assistance, or advanced AI development, OpenClaw skills offer a versatile and powerful toolset to shape the future of AI-driven operations.